Rhythm Space and Character: Creating Fun Dynamic Characters for the Stage & Page

For writers, actors, directors, comedians, dancer/movers....

August 7, 2021 from 4 to 7pm

$45 @ the Grange Hall Cultural Center, Waterbury Center, VT

This workshop is open to all levels, ages 16 and older!

Want to spice up your writing, your stage work, your comedy routines, or your physical performance?  Bronwyn Sims, professional actor, clown, and dancer will inspire you to lift your creative work to new levels!

Explore the fundamental building blocks of dramatic action and theater through the Lecoq technique, we will work on rhythm and space two fundamental aspects of the journey. We will find the physical "jeu!" (play) in all aspects of what we create on page or stage. This work trains students to develop a heightened presence, a deep awareness of the demands of performance, and an ability to create new worlds by connecting the body, breath, and gaze.

We will play with text and physicality and come up with one (or two!) original characters that you create through movement and imagination. We will work in solos, duos, and small groups to collaboratively create dynamic and fun material. Bring a notebook to write down your ideas and discoveries!

Please come prepared to move in comfortable clothing. For better concentration and focus on the work, neutrally based color clothing is preferred (black, but grey and or blue is also acceptable). No logos or other colors please.

Bronwyn Sims is a creator, performer, director, choreographer, and educator.

Bronwyn is a registered teaching artist through the state of Vermont and is a member of NEFA’S Creative Ground. She has been awarded grants from The Vermont Community Foundation, The Vermont Arts Council, and The Network of Ensemble Theaters.

She has appeared in theatre, film and on television. She has performed throughout New England, New York, Pennsylvania, California, Colorado and Europe. Bronwyn was a Lecturer in Acting at Yale School of Drama, and on the faculty at New England Center for Circus Arts. Bronwyn was the acrobatics and movement instructor at The Pig Iron School for Advanced Performance Training and has conducted guest master classes throughout the country. She holds an MFA in Devised Physical Theatre Performance from The University of The Arts and Pig Iron School for Advanced Performance Training. She holds a Certificate in Acting from Circle in the Square Theatre School.

She is also Co-Founder and Producing Director of Strong Coffee Stage, a Physical Theatre Company based in Vermont, and a member and dance affiliate with The Vermont Dance Alliance. www.bronwynsims.com
